About The Role

For informal enquiries, please contact Neil Williams (Electrical Services Manager) Neil.Williams.1@warwick.ac.uk

This role includes installing and maintaining electrical equipment, planned maintenance and remedial works within residential, commercial, and industrial premise. As one of our apprentices you will be fully supported throughout.

About You

We are seeking an ideal candidate with prior experience in the electrical industry, preferably as a trainee. The ideal candidate should have successfully achieved a Level 2 technical certificate and commenced or completed the Level 3 certificate, with a pending requirement to complete the AM2 assessment.

About The Department

The Estates Office looks after the Warwick University campus - the land it’s built on and the buildings it’s made up of. It’s mission is to “make and care for places and spaces where people are continually inspired, and our services valued”.

Here is your chance to be part of the team that makes Warwick University’s Estates Department one of the most enjoyable places to work in the Coventry area. Our mission is to deliver excellent customer service by creating, operating, and sustaining safe, high-quality environments.

The Electrical Maintenance team provides the University of Warwick with all services relating to the operation and maintenance of building structures and associated building engineering services. We are responsible for the operations and maintenance of a wide variety of complex equipment throughout the University Estate such as High Voltage /Low Voltage power distribution systems, critical power supplies, localised small power, lighting, security, life safety systemsand building energy management systems.
